They can boost the comfort of your home
The windows in your home play a significant role in ensuring your comfort. They let in sunlight and keep your home warm or cool, depending on the weather. Replace your windows to increase the comfort of your home. Replacement windows can boost the price of reselling your home and will make it more energy efficient.
If properly maintained windows that are of high-quality can last up to 20 years. They'll eventually exhibit signs like broken glass and warped frames. These are signs that it's the right time to replace your windows. Additionally older windows tend to have their insulation properties reduced and can result in higher energy bills. Moreover, these windows can let in moisture in your home and cause wood decay.
When you are looking to replace your windows, choose windows that have the highest efficiency ratings. These windows will stop heat loss in the winter and reduce costs for energy by keeping your home cooler in summer. You can also find windows with a low U-factor which prevents heat from getting out of your home. Some windows have argon gas pumped in-between window panes to increase their insulation properties.
New replacement windows also block UV rays that can harm carpets and furniture. In addition they keep you safe from burglars and increase the comfort in your home.
Modern replacement windows are simpler to clean and more secure than older windows. They let more light into your home which can brighten up a room and make it seem bigger. They can also be moved to allow for more air circulation. Additionally, the majority of modern windows are designed with safety exits to help you escape in the event in an emergency. Some windows even have built-in blinds or shades that can reduce dust and allergens in your home. This can make your home more comfortable. You can also select windows that offer privacy with features such as tinting or patterns with decorative designs. Windows that are new can also help reduce noise from outside, which is crucial for those living in busy location.
